.block4{display:inline-block}.block4 .title{border-bottom:#ccc 1px dotted;padding:13px 2px}.block4 .title:after,.block4 .cnt:after{content:".";display:block;height:0;clear:both;visibility:hidden}.block4 .title h4{float:left;font-size:15px;font-weight:normal;padding:0;margin:0 !important}.block4 .title h5{float:right;font-weight:normal;padding:0;margin:0}.block4 .content{padding:10px}#orderform thead th{padding:4px 4px 4px 4px;color:#888;font-size:12px}#orderform tbody{padding-top:10px;padding-bottom:10px}#orderform th{padding:4px 4px 4px 4px;vertical-align:top;text-align:left;color:#6c6c6c;font-weight:normal}#orderform td{padding:4px;vertical-align:middle}#orderform input,#orderform select{-webkit-border-radius:2px;-moz-border-radius:2px;border-radius:2px;line-height:18px;color:#595959;border:1px solid #cfcfcf}#orderform .services input,#orderform input.checker{border:0}#orderform .services tbody{padding:0}#orderform .services tbody td{padding:0 2px 4px 2px}#orderform .services input{margin-top:0;margin-bottom:0}#orderpage{width:950px;margin:0 auto 30px auto}#orderpage h1{margin:30px 0 25px 0;font-size:18px;font-weight:normal;font-family:Arial,"microsoft yahei",Helvetica,sans-serif}#orderpage .ordercnt{background-color:#fff;-ms-box-shadow:0 1px 3px 0 rgba(0,0,0,0.2);-moz-box-shadow:0 1px 3px 0 rgba(0,0,0,0.2);-webkit-box-shadow:0 1px 3px 0 rgba(0,0,0,0.2);box-shadow:0 1px 3px 0 rgba(0,0,0,0.2)}#opleft{width:50%;float:left;padding:15px 25px}#opright{width:50%;float:right;padding:15px 25px}.orderPhones{width:100%}.orderPhones th,.orderPhones td{padding:3px}.orderPhones th{text-align:left;font-weight:normal}.orderPhones thead th{padding-bottom:12px}.orderPhones tbody td{color:#f60}#orderTelContact{background-image:url(/dir-res/2012/img/pbg.gif);padding:7px;margin-right:20px;width:360px;margin-left:70px}#orderTelContact div{background:#fff url(/dir-res/2012/img/orderContactBg.gif) 0 bottom repeat-x;padding:20px;height:200px}#orderTelContact h3{font-size:15px;font-weight:normal;margin-bottom:12px}#orderpage .errMsg{color:#c00;font-size:15px;font-weight:bold;margin:40px 0 40px 0;text-align:center}#orderresult{width:950px;margin:auto;padding-top:60px}#orderresult.success{background:url(/dir-res/2012/img/orderComplete_bg.jpg) right 0 no-repeat;height:468px}#orderresult.fail{height:278px}#orderresult h3{font-size:18px;font-weight:normal;margin-bottom:8px}#orderresult.success h3{color:#f60}#orderresult.fail h3{color:#c00}